Bank of America suggests that the dominant period of major stocks leading market gains may be concluding. According to BofA's Savita Subramanian, the market could shift from a downturn to a recovery phase, which may impact the performance of megacap stocks that benefited during previous phases. The company notes that while large-cap technology has thrived recently, signs of market rotation, particularly among small-cap stocks, could indicate a changing landscape ahead.
